Stanislau Shushkevich: “An agreement in the frames of CSTO is new Warsaw Pact”
18- 5.02.2009, 13:39
Stanislau Shushkevich, former head of the Supreme Council of Belarus, condemned creation of collective response forces in the frames of the CSTO (Collective Security Treaty Organization).
“It’s a new Warsaw Pact,” Stanislau Shushkevich commented on the agreement on creation of collective response forces to the Charter’97 press center. “It will be a structure, controlled by Russia. Counter-NATO. Actions of Lukashenka are deviation from all norms of the Belarusian laws. It was a promise that our troops wouldn’t take part in international conflicts, now it is broken. Russia has brought to heel many post-Soviet countries, expect for Ukraine, Georgia, and the Baltic countries. Russia takes Belarus by the throat. Our people suffered most of all during the Great Patriotic War. They decided to hide behind the Belarusian people again. We shouldn’t sign these pacts. We have no enemies on the West and on the East.”
Stanislau Shushkevich commented on the recent statement of Russian president Dmitry Medvedev, who said the CSTO response forces wouldn’t be less effective than similar NATO structures.
“It’s ridiculous. NATO is a defensive organization. It is senseless to resist it. One should understand that it is an old imperial Russian policy to oppress everyone they can. They want to protect themselves with lives of the brotherly peoples. I’d like to note that it is a purpose of not Russia but of the Russian authorities,” Stanislau Shushkevich said.
Former head of the Supreme Council of Belarus also responded a statement of Lukashenka who said that Belarus wouldn’t take part in international conflicts in the frames of the collective response forces.
“Assurances of Lukashenka can make a cat laugh. He said on December 17 there would be no devaluation in Belarus. He said this to his people on TV. What do we have in result? We shouldn’t believe Lukashenka,” the politician thinks.
